In this work a series of tetrakis complexes C[Tm(acac)4], where C+=Li+, Na+ and K+ countercations and acac=acetylacetonate ligand, were synthesized and characterized for photoluminescence investigation. The relevant aspect is that these complexes are water-free in the first coordination sphere. The emission spectra of the tetrakis Tm3+-complexes present narrow bands characteristic of the 1G43H6 (479 nm), 1G43F4 (650 nm) and 1G43H5 (779 nm) transitions of the Tm3+ ion, with the blue emission color at 479 nm as the most prominent one. The lifetime values (τ) of the emitting 1G4 level of the C[Tm(acac)4] complexes were 344, 360 and 400 ns for the Li+, Na+ and K+ countercations, respectively, showing an increasing linear behavior versus the ionic radius of the alkaline ion. An efficient intramolecular energy transfer process from the triplet state (T) of the ligands to the emitting 1G4 state of the Tm3+ ion is observed. This fact, together with the absence of water molecules in first coordination sphere, allows these tetrakis Tm3+-complexes to act as efficient blue light conversion molecular devices.  相似文献

We study graded limits of simple -modules which are isomorphic to tensor products of Kirillov–Reshetikhin modules associated to a fixed fundamental weight. We prove that every such module admits a graded limit which is isomorphic to the fusion product of the graded limits of its tensor factors. Moreover, using recent results of Naoi, we exhibit a set of defining relations for these graded limits.  相似文献

In this paper we address the problem of localizing fermion states on stable domain-wall junctions. The study focus on the consequences of intersecting six independent 8d domain walls to form 4d junctions in a ten-dimensional spacetime. This is related to the mechanism of relaxing to three space dimensions through the formation of domain-wall junctions. The model is based on six bulk real scalar fields, the φ 4 model in its broken phase, the prototype of the Higgs field, and is such that the fermion and scalar modes bound to the domain walls are the zero mode and a single massive bound state, which can be regarded as a two-level system, at least at sufficiently low energy. Inside the junction, we use the fact that some states are statistically more favored to address the possibility of constraining the flavor number of the elementary fermions.  相似文献

Luminescent films containing terbium complex [Tb(acac)3(H2O)3] (acac=acetylacetonate) doped into a polycarbonate (PC) matrix were prepared and irradiated at low-dose gamma radiation with ratio of 5 and 10 kGy. The PC polymer was doped with 5% (w/w) of the Tb3+ complex. The thermal behavior was investigated by utilization of differential scanning calorimetry (DSC) and thermogravimetry analysis (TGA). Changes in thermal stability due to the addition of doping agent into the polycarbonate matrix. Based on the emission spectra of PC:5% Tb(acac)3 film were observed the characteristic bands arising from the 5D47FJ transitions of Tb3+ ion (J=0–6), indicating the ability to obtain the luminescent films. Doped samples irradiated at low dose of gamma irradiation showed a decrease in luminescence intensity with increasing of the dose.  相似文献
